I had a chance to try it out over my lunch break, and sure enough - having flipping issues with the new R-7. I'll post a craft, and maybe a youtube, when I get home.

Very basic "sputnik" style R-7 without upper stage, 12 vernier config, one small fin (the small stock static one) on each booster.

Climb to 8000 meters, start to very slowly and gently edge the nose east

Within seconds, the entire rocket flips and won't recover, flying bottom-first unable to flip back around.

I tried a second time and covered the whole rocket with standard canards and RCS, and still had trouble but was able to at least get into orbit without flipping over.

Also found that the stock radial decouplers are having trouble ejecting the booster tanks with enough force to eject clear of the center stage/tank to avoid collisions.

That's really strange. I tried two different launcher configurations (Vostok-K and Soyuz-FG), and they both performed beautifully. Are you throttling back at all to account for the dynamic pressure on the vehicle? Going full-throttle through the entire ascent leaves you almost no latitude with the angle of attack and will most assuredly send your booster flipping.
